3. Responsibilities
- As the organiser of the event You retain full responsibility for ensuring that a satisfactory risk assessment has been carried out for the event.
- You must ensure that the event is properly stewarded, so that our personnel do not find themselves in threatening situations.
- You must ensure that an area for the treatment of patients is clearly defined. A dry, covered, clean area can be provided either by You or by Us.
- You must ensure that We have free and clear access and egress to and from the site of the event for K.F.A.E personnel and vehicles. (This also includes K.F.A.E staff’s private transport) or suitable parking made available for said vehicles.
- You must ensure that all additional medical personnel at the event are made known to K.F.A.E event manager, before the commencement of the event.
- You must adhere to any request to stop the event while treatment takes place.
- Your event staff should be made aware of where the Medical Tent and personnel are located, to assist any requests from participants or spectators.
- Should the event be of such a size that You are using, maps, plans and or radio equipment, Our personnel should be provided with them. It is Your responsibility to ensure an appropriate system/route of communication is made known to Us.
- You are responsible for ensuring that all necessary licenses to operate the event have been obtained and for compliance with all conditions associated with such licences and in respect of all relevant legislation, regulations or similar. Failure to comply with the requirements of this clause may be treated by K.F.A.E as a fundamental breach of this Agreement, in which case K.F.A.E shall be entitled to immediately terminate its attendance at the event. This will not affect K.F.A.E right to be paid for Our services (whether performed or not).
4. Our responsibilities (and limitations to the same)
We will provide first aid services at the event in a manner commensurate with good practice in first aid delivery. These services are provided subject to the following limitations, and should not be viewed as a substitute for any need for registered doctors, nurses or paramedic at the event. These must be requested by You on the Event booking Form.
- We may carry out our own risk assessments, but these are for our own purposes. You remain fully responsible for Your event (see Your responsibilities above).
- Our K.F.A.E manager at the event shall conduct the deployment of our personnel. They are responsible for the health and safety of K.F.A.E staff and have a legal obligation under the Health and Safety at Work Act.
- In the unlikely event of a life threatening situation occurring in the vicinity of Your event, our staff at Your event may be requested to respond (subject to reduced first aid provision remaining at the event). Should this occur, K.F.A.E reserve the right to leave the event without notice. We accept no liability for any losses You may incur due to the termination of the event, should the cause be due to Our full or partial withdrawal.
- In view of the circumstances specified earlier in this Clause, You are advised to arrange appropriate 'Event Cancellation' insurance. We will not accept liability for any loss which you incur in relation to cancellation which could have been covered by such insurance.
- Neither K.F.A.E nor K.F.A.E staff shall be liable under any circumstances, for any damage to land or property in the event of access being required to a casualty or to allow egress from a site.
- At Your request K.F.A.E may use an off road all terrain Argocat 6 x 6 vehicle to move patients to their static on-site Medical Centre. K.F.A.E will not convey any patient off site but will liaise with the County Ambulance Service to arrange their attendance.
- Subject to Clause below, neither We nor Our personnel shall have any liability to You or any third party, for any loss, expense or damage of any nature, suffered or occurred arising from any breach of any condition of the Agreement or any negligence or any breach of statutory or other duty or in any other way in connection with performance or purported performance of or failure to perform the Agreement.
- Nothing in this Contract shall be taken to exclude liability for death or
personal injury resulting from Our (or Our personnel’s) negligence. - We shall not be liable for any failure in performance of any of K.F.A.E obligations under the Agreement caused by factors outside of Our control (including but not limited to fire, storm, flood etc.)
- It is Your sole responsibility as the body organising the event to ensure that the level of cover requested complies with all statutory regulations and requirements laid down by any governing body relating to such event.
- Acceptance of all events (and the fees quoted) for the provision of resources is made on the understanding that the details of the event submitted to K.F.A.E are accurate and correct. If K.F.A.E is not notified of changes to these details, such as levels of resources, duration, time or location of event, K.F.A.E reserve the right to revise our fees, or to reconsider our acceptance of the event. If upon arrival at the event, the K.F.A.E duty manager in attendance considers the event to be larger or of a higher risk than stated on the booking form or subsequent correspondence, K.F.A.E reserve the right to withdraw from the event. In such circumstances all reasonable effort shall be made to advise the contact name on the booking form of the reasons for withdrawal. Should it be necessary at this stage to withdraw from the event, full charges will apply for the resources provided, and K.F.A.E accept no liability for any loss you may incur due to the termination of the event in such circumstances.
- With regard to details of persons treated by K.F.A.E staff, personal information will only be provided upon a request by legal representation and/or by written consent of the individual concerned, all subject at all times to the Data Protection Act 1998.
